Likely doesn't impact most on this list, but it is a sub-sea fiber cut in an interesting place - https://alaskapublic.org/2023/06/12/cut-cable-causes-weeks-long-north-slope-... Looks like it will be down until sometime in July when the sea ice melts enough for the ships to get in and make repairs. I know Quintillion has been looking to run cables both to Asia and Europe using these arctic routes, but I wonder how common these types of long outages could be as we put more and more infra in these arctic climates.
